Myths & truths : You earn more in Europe ?
• Income & taxes on 3000€ salary in Belgium
• 42% in your pocket : 1250 €
• Income & taxes on 1500€ salary in Ukraine (self-employed)
• 90% in your pocket : 1350 €
• Gross & Net are 2 different world
Myths & truths : free social protection
• Lot of taxes but at least social security is great !– 40% of salary goes to social security…. (hardly free)
• Hospital costs : pretty much free
• Doctors : 30-50% reimbursed– GP : 10$– Dentist : 50$
• Appointment ? Earliest one is in 3 weeks, interested ?
Myths & truths : taxes are high ?
• Euphemism
• Taxes on income : up to 50%
• Taxes on bonus : up to 70%
• Social security : up to 40%
• Engineers with salary above 2500$ a month will pay up to 60-70% of taxes
Difference in hiring process
• LinkedIn is more used
• Majority of recruiting company
• Length of process :– Multiple interview (recruiter, HR, technical lead, manager, HR)– Legal constraint : work permit (couple weeks), residency permit
(months)
• Contract signing & package negotiation
Working attitude : teamwork & overtime
• Internal resources : cheaper, hard to fire
• Consultant : expensive, easy to fire
• Outsource : SLA based, expensive
• Paid/compensated overtime
Working attitude : Growth & promotion
• Internal growth :– Training– Promotion– Salary increase
• Promotion– depending on internal turnover & external turnover– Age/gender based
Good, the bad & the ugly
• Good:– Job safety– Benefit in kind : company car, phone, home internet, hospital
protection– Vacation, parental leave, sabbatical leave– Social security : hospital, unemployment (non limited in time…)
• Bad– Salary increase (1-2% a year)– Difficulty to get promotion– Legal constraint : work permit, residency– Cultural challenges & mentality
• Ugly– Taxes
